Adaptive Health Behaviors The Patterns of Adapting To Health (PATH)
15
Adaptive Health Behaviors PATH 3: Wisely Frugal Active health information seekers Low exercise Some nutrition Emotional stress, anxiety Chronic allergies, respiratory conditions PATH 1: Critically Discerning Some physical activity Some health literacy Uninvolved in wellness reactive to health problems emotional stress, anxiety, sleeplessness Obesity PATH 2: Health Contented Avoids health care disinterest in health sedentary lifestyle poor diet Disinterest in health information Obesity Emotional stress, anxiety, sleeplessness, depression, migraines Patterns of Adapting to Health (PATH)
16
Adaptive Health Behaviors PATH 4: Traditionalist Sedentary lifestyle Poor diet Low health literacy High rates of chronic disease and health risks Underutilize prescription medications External locus of control (depends on others) PATH 5: Family Centered Family’s health above all other health matters Constantly seek to enhance family health Moderate physical activity Moderate health literacy Most sensitive to the age and life stage of the population Obesity Postpartum depression PATH 6: Family Driven Moderation in all health care opinions and behaviors Moderate interest in health information nutrition and physical fitness Higher rates of illness/disease increasing medical claims
17
Adaptive Health Behaviors PATH 7: Healthcare Driven Involved in good nutrition/healthy dieting Moderate physical exercise High health literacy Frequent use of healthcare care Highest rates of most diagnosed diseases Highest medical costs “Proactive health and wellness” PATH 8: Independently Healthy Vigorous physical activity good nutrition/healthy diet High health literacy The healthiest, most active lower rates of all diseases “fitness” PATH 9: Naturalist Use of alternative health Good nutrition Moderately active High health literacy lack of trust in medical professionals Higher rates of heart disease, skin cancer, breast cancer, migraines, high cholesterol “Proactive health and wellness”
